Daisy Chaining of Outputs
Daisy chaining (jumping from one DC/DC-converter output to the next) is
permitted, as long as the average output current through one terminal pin
does not exceed 25 A. If the current is higher, use a separate distribution
terminal block.
Lifetime Expectancy
The Lifetime expectancy that is shown in the table indicates the minimum
operating hours (service life) and is determined by the lifetime expectancy of
the built-in electrolytic capacitors. Lifetime expectancy is specified in
operational hours and is calculated according to the capacitor’s manufacturer
specification.
The manufacturer of the electrolytic capacitors only states a maximum life of
up to 15 years (131,400 hr). Any number that exceeds this value is a calculated
theoretical lifetime, which can be used to compare devices.
Mean Time Between Failure
Mean time between failure (MTBF) is calculated according to statistical device
failures, and indicates reliability of a device. The MTBF value is a statistical
representation of the likelihood of a unit to fail and does not necessarily
represent the life of a product. An MTBF value of, for example, 1,000,000 hr
means that statistically one unit fails every 100 hours if 10,000 units are
installed in the field. However, it cannot be determined if the failed unit has
been running for 50,000 hr or only for 100 hr.
For these types of units, the Mean Time to Failure (MTTF) value is the same as
the MTBF value.
